👀 SPOILER-FREE SUMMARY

Beelzebub leans hard into its romantic comedy chops here, weaponizing misunderstandings between Oga, Hildegarde, and Aoi for maximum chaos. The introduction of the delinquent squad MK-5 injects fresh energy into an already frenetic dynamic, escalating the absurdity with new rivalries and confrontations. Expect rapid-fire gags stacked on top of posturing tough guys who have no idea what they've walked into. The episode's title isn't subtle — romance is treated like a natural disaster, and the collateral damage is mostly to everyone's dignity. Pacing is brisk and doesn't linger, bouncing between comedic setups and the kind of overblown delinquent showdowns the series thrives on. If you've been enjoying the show's ability to turn every social interaction into a battlefield, this episode delivers exactly that energy without slowing down.

📍 ARC CONTEXT

Picking up directly from episode 8's groundwork around Aoi's growing feelings toward Oga, this ninth episode deepens those relationship dynamics while introducing MK-5 as a new faction in the delinquent hierarchy. Still early in the 60-episode run, the series is actively expanding its cast and layering in romantic tension that will fuel storylines well beyond this point. This episode serves as a bridge between initial character introductions and the larger group conflicts ahead.
